Transaction 055741b1974936bf8856568915852f201cda3ca8eaec47a5bce4707cd7e8a7ad

8 Input
2 Outputs
  • 055741b1974936bf8856568915852f201cda3ca8eaec47a5bce4707cd7e8a7ad:0
  • value  5857886
    address  16huFAd8youAigN7pwYW6GTDMzTYYsKvAY
  • 055741b1974936bf8856568915852f201cda3ca8eaec47a5bce4707cd7e8a7ad:1
  • value  1000005
    address  3MCjiMFPjdDMvRqm1aEqd361U6gFL8JkHW